MySQL导入导出



MySQL的数据库导出有很多种,我现在就介绍一下MySQL自带的mysqldump命令导出导入。

注:导出时,按照mysql表编码导出。如果导入时,mysql服务器端的编码不和表一致,导入出错。

1、MySQL导出整个数据库表结构及数据命令:



[sql]  view plain  copy




  1. mysqldump -u用户名 -p密码 dbName>f:\路径+导出SQL的名称  




注:生成.sql文件,可是是多个数据库,多个数据库用逗号分隔。

2、MySQL导出数据库单个表表结构及数据命令:



[sql]  view plain  copy




  1. mysqldump -u用户名 -p密码 数据库名 表名 >f:\路径+导出SQL的名称  




注:多个表可以用逗号分隔。

3、MySQL导出整个数据库表结构命令:



[sql]  view plain  copy




    1. mysqldump -u用户名 -p密码 -d 数据库名>f:\路径+导出SQL的名称




    注:整个数据库表结构,生成.sql文件。

    4、MySQL导出数据库单个表结构命令:



    [sql]  view plain  copy




    1. mysqldump -u用户名 -p密码 -d 数据库名 表名 >f:\路径+导出SQL的名称  



    注:单个表结构,生成.sql文件,可是多张表。多表以空格区分

     

    MySQL的导入:

    1)进入cmd

    2)



    [sql]  view plain  copy



    1. mysql -h localhost -u用户名 -p密码


    3)



    [sql]  view plain  copy



    1. mysql -h -localhost -u用户名 -p密码 进入mysql  
    2. create database test  
    3. use test  
    4. source f:\test.sql



    除了以上的方法,还有mysqlimport、Load Data等。除了以上的方法,还有mysqlimport、Load Data等

    MySQL的数据库导出有很多种,我现在就介绍一下MySQL自带的mysqldump命令导出导入。

    注:导出时,按照mysql表编码导出。如果导入时,mysql服务器端的编码不和表一致,导入出错。

    1、MySQL导出整个数据库表结构及数据命令:



    [sql]  view plain  copy




      1. mysqldump -u用户名 -p密码 dbName>f:\路径+导出SQL的名称




      注:生成.sql文件,可是是多个数据库,多个数据库用逗号分隔。

      2、MySQL导出数据库单个表表结构及数据命令:



      [sql]  view plain  copy


      1. mysqldump -u用户名 -p密码 数据库名 表名 >f:\路径+导出SQL的名称


      注:多个表可以用逗号分隔。

      3、MySQL导出整个数据库表结构命令:



      [sql]  view plain  copy



      1. mysqldump -u用户名 -p密码 -d 数据库名>f:\路径+导出SQL的名称



      注:整个数据库表结构,生成.sql文件。

      4、MySQL导出数据库单个表结构命令:



      [sql]  view plain  copy



      1. mysqldump -u用户名 -p密码 -d 数据库名 表名 >f:\路径+导出SQL的名称


      注:单个表结构,生成.sql文件,可是多张表。多表以空格区分

       

      MySQL的导入:

      1)进入cmd
       2)
       
       
      [sql]  
          view plain 
           copy 
          
       
          
       
           
        
      1. mysql -h localhost -u用户名 -p密码  
       
       
       3)
       
       
      [sql]  
          view plain 
           copy 
          
       
          
       
           
        
      1. mysql -h -localhost -u用户名 -p密码 进入mysql  
      2. create database test  
      3. use test  
      4. source f:\test.sql


      除了以上的方法,还有mysqlimport、Load Data等。除了以上的方法,还有mysqlimport、Load Data等